Not even close. The Munich Agreement was signed between Hitler & Mussolini on one side and Prime Minister Chamberlain and Premier Daladier of France on the other. There were no other signaturies present. Not even the Czech government was allowed by Hitler to be present.

No the Munich putsch was not a disaster for the Nazi party because even though they failed to achieve their goal which was to overthrow the Bavarian government, it made Hitler believe that the only way to take power is through Law. Which in the end proved important. So in the short term it failed but in the long term it proved to be decisive.
